His temptation
The apple hung without knowing fear without knowing death until temptation robbed it and me and you and all of life and we must be charged because we came from Him whom created the temptation that devoured the apple that desired fear and wanted death for all of us to share. But temptation was not His intention and death was not His answer His choice was freedom but we took advantage of His generosity desiring to have it all and yet still He loves us with His grace so amazing that He gave to us His only begotten Son Whom conquered death and wanted eternal life for all of us to share.
